Like a
new strain of an infectious disease, crime is spreading across the
English-speaking Caribbean with no sign of a cure. Regrettably,
Caribbean Governments’ response to rising crime is often knee-jerk and
sophomoric. As rising cost of living, crime, HIV-Aids, hurricanes and
free trade pressurize the small economies of Caricom, the idea of a
political union might not seem so far-fetched after all.
